What is a Degree?

The Degree (°) is a measurement of a plane angle, defined so that a full rotation is 360 degrees. It is the most common unit for angle measurement in geometry and everyday measuring.

How to Convert Degree to Octant

To convert Degree to Octant, divide the Degree value by 45.

oct = ° ÷ 45
